PHOTOS: Osinbajo Meets APC Senators In Abuja

April 13, 2022

Nigeria’s Vice president, Prof. Yemi Osinbajo between Tuesday night and early Wednesday morning met with Senators of the ruling All Progressives Congress (APC) at the Aguda House ,in Aso Rock  Abuja.

The meeting according to the Senate President, Ahmed Lawan was to formally inform them about his aspiration to contest for 2023 presidency.

It would be recalled that the vice president on Monday morning declared his interest to contest for presidency in the 2023 elections under the platform of the APC.
